Power is becoming one of AI’s biggest constraints. Hyperscalers are committing hundreds of billions of dollars to AI infrastructure, yet power availability remains a major constraint. As AI moves beyond the data center and into the physical world, the challenge becomes even more acute. Robots, drones, autonomous systems, and other intelligent machines must operate within strict power and thermal limits.

This is also an enormous opportunity. Physical AI has the potential to transform a $30 trillion global labor market – I explored this idea in my prior newsletter on Labor as a Service.

Velaura is making ultra-low-power AI computing practical for Physical AI and more efficient in the data center. By building purpose-built silicon and software for both hyperscalers and physical AI, the team is creating the compute foundation needed to deploy AI at scale—from the world’s largest data centers to intelligent machines operating in the physical world.
